Summary

Diagnoses the underlying social trends and sets out a two-step guide to finding lasting love. This book explains the defences that stop us getting hurt but also serve as barriers to potential new relationships; and how like attracts like, and how to work on balancing yourself to bring similarly balanced people into your life.

Andrew G Marshall is the UK's best-known marital therapist and writer on relationships. He regularly writes for The Times, the Mail on Sunday, the Sunday Express and Woman & Home. He has also appeared on programmes such as the Lorraine Kelly Today and the Chris Evans Show on BBC Radio 2. He is the author of I Love You But I'm Not in Love With You and the play Coming Round Again. He lives in West Sussex.
